If you do not open the doors within 30 seconds, the doors are
relocked automatically for security.
The beeper sounds when:
The power mode is in ACCESSORY.
The exterior lights are left on.
The Auto Idle Stop is in operation.
The beeper sounds if you move outside the walk away auto lock
operating range before the door completely closes.
2 Locking the doors (Walk away auto lock®) (P117)
The beeper sounds when:
Driver and/or front passenger are not wearing their seat belts.
The parking brake pedal is not fully released.
The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S) needs attention.
Check tire pressure.
